Tumbleweed's Classification as an Annual
π± Genetic and Physiological Traits
Tumbleweed, belonging to the genus Salsola, showcases unique characteristics that define its classification as an annual plant. Its genetic makeup allows it to thrive in harsh conditions, making it a fascinating subject for study.
Physiologically, Tumbleweed exhibits remarkable drought resistance. This trait, combined with a rapid growth rate, enables it to complete its lifecycle in a short time frame, adapting quickly to environmental changes.
β³ Lifecycle
The lifecycle of Tumbleweed consists of several distinct stages: germination, vegetative growth, flowering, seed production, and senescence. Each stage is crucial for the plant's survival and reproduction.
Typically, Tumbleweed completes its lifecycle within just a few months. This swift progression is essential for its survival in unpredictable environments.
πΎ Growth Patterns
Tumbleweed grows in a bushy structure that eventually breaks off and rolls across the landscape. This unique growth form not only aids in seed dispersal but also helps the plant adapt to its surroundings.
In arid environments, Tumbleweed efficiently utilizes available resources. Its ability to thrive with minimal water makes it a resilient player in the ecosystem, showcasing nature's ingenuity in survival strategies.

Reproductive Strategies
πΌ Flowering Process
Tumbleweed typically flowers in late summer, a strategic timing that aligns with its lifecycle. The flowers are small and inconspicuous, yet they play a crucial role in attracting pollinators.
Pollinators are essential for the plant's reproduction, ensuring that the seeds produced are viable. This relationship highlights the importance of even the smallest flowers in the ecosystem.
π± Seed Production and Dispersal
One of the most remarkable traits of Tumbleweed is its high seed output, producing hundreds to thousands of seeds per plant. This prolific nature allows it to quickly colonize new areas.
The seeds are dispersed through two primary methods: wind and the plant's rolling movement across landscapes. This unique dispersal strategy enables Tumbleweed to thrive in various environments, ensuring its survival and spread.
